The Impact of Urbanization and Development

Urbanization and development substantially threaten firefly habitats by transforming natural landscapes into built environments. When you build roads, houses, and commercial areas, you fragment and reduce the open spaces fireflies depend on. Deforestation and intensive agriculture further shrink their habitat, isolating populations and making it harder to find mates. Coastal development has wiped out many freshwater wetlands, which are essential for some firefly species. As urban areas expand, the loss of native plants and soil disturbance disrupts the delicate ecosystems fireflies rely on for breeding and shelter. If you live in a rapidly growing region, your local landscape might be disappearing before your eyes, putting firefly populations at risk of decline or extinction. Conserving natural spaces is imperative for keeping fireflies thriving. Additionally, urban heat islands created by dense development can alter local microclimates, further impacting firefly activity and lifecycle. These microclimate changes can lead to hotter, drier conditions that are less suitable for firefly development and reproduction. Furthermore, the loss of native vegetation diminishes the availability of resources necessary for firefly sustenance and breeding.

The Role of Pesticides in Firefly Population Decline

While reducing light pollution helps fireflies communicate and reproduce, pesticides pose an even greater threat to their populations. Pesticides like neonicotinoids and broad-spectrum chemicals directly harm firefly larvae and adults, disrupting their development and survival. Lawn chemicals and mosquito sprays kill firefly larvae and their prey, reducing food sources and hindering population growth. Soil and leaf litter contaminated with pesticides create inhospitable environments, making it difficult for fireflies to complete their life cycle. Since fireflies spend part of their life underground or in leaf litter, pesticide use in yards and agricultural areas markedly declines their numbers. Reducing or eliminating pesticide use supports firefly conservation by allowing populations to recover and thrive naturally.

Climate Change and Its Effects on Firefly Habitats

Climate change directly impacts firefly habitats by altering temperature and weather patterns, making environments less suitable for their survival. Rising temperatures can push some species beyond their tolerance, especially in southern regions, leading to declines. Droughts and storms become more frequent, destroying breeding sites and drying out moist habitats fireflies depend on. Warmer weather may also allow certain firefly species to expand into new areas, but this shift disrupts existing ecosystems. Are All Firefly Species Equally Affected by Habitat Loss?

Not all firefly species are equally affected by habitat loss. You should know that geographically confined species in the Southeast, mid-Atlantic, and Southwest are especially vulnerable because their habitats are shrinking rapidly. Some species with broader ranges might be less impacted, but overall, habitat loss threatens many fireflies. By protecting natural areas and reducing development, you can help preserve the diversity of firefly species across different regions.

Which Pesticides Are Most Harmful to Firefly Larvae?

Neonicotinoid pesticides are the most harmful to firefly larvae, reducing populations by up to 90%. Broad-spectrum pesticides, including lawn chemicals and mosquito sprays, also pose significant threats by killing larvae and disrupting their development. You should avoid using these chemicals in your yard. Instead, opt for natural pest control methods and reduce pesticide use to help protect firefly larvae and support their populations.
